The plastic packs and sacks are created from two sort of plastic materials, which are biodegradable and non-biodegradable. In 2017, over 85% of plastic packs and sacks were produced from non-biodegradable materials, for example, HDPE, LDPE, LLDPE, PP, PS and different plastics. The non-biodegradable plastics are the profoundly favored material for the creation of plastic packs and sacks, because of cost viability and bountiful accessibility of the material. When contrasted with non-biodegradable plastics, biodegradable plastic burns-through huge measure of assets for preparing, prompting greater expense of the material. Biodegradable plastic packs and sacks are eco-accommodating and decomposable when contrasted with the oil-based plastics (non-biodegradable plastic).

New York State initiated its plastic pack boycott, joining seven different states trying to diminish litter, trash in landfills, sea contamination, and damage to marine life. Walk 1 was additionally the day that New York recognized its first Covid case. What's more, notwithstanding the way that California was the main state to boycott plastic sacks in 2014, San Francisco has turned around its plastic pack boycott due to the Covid, banning the utilization of reusable shopping sacks, which are equipped for spreading viral and bacterial ailments. New Hampshire, Massachusetts, Oregon and Maine have likewise prohibited reusable packs or deferred their plastic sack boycotts for the time being as have various urban communities.
